Trosolwg o'r swydd

Come and be part of something meaningful, where your everyday work helps support life-changing outcomes for patients.

This is an exciting opportunity to join our Specialist Falls Service where your skills, organisation, and attention to detail will play a vital role in supporting patient care.

As an Administrator within our friendly and supportive team, you’ll play a key role in keeping our service running smoothly. Your role will be varied and rewarding, including managing referrals, maintaining accurate data, being a point of contact for our team, developing triage skills,  responding to patient queries, and coordinating equipment and stock. Your contribution will enable our clinicians to focus on delivering high-quality, patient-centred assessment and care.

You’ll be at the heart of a service that’s continually evolving, where your ideas and input are valued. We recognise the importance of our administrative team, not just for what you do, but for the insight and improvements you bring.

  • This is a permanent post
  • Working 37.5 hours per week Monday to Friday
  • Based at Southmead Health centre with free parking available 

Prif ddyletswyddau'r swydd

  • Play a key role in the team, contributing to the day-to-day administration that keeps the service running smoothly
  • Work independently and collaboratively, using your initiative while also supporting colleagues to prioritise and manage workloads
  • Manage referrals, inputting and processing information on the EMIS system in line with service protocols and escalating potential issues
  • Be a first point of contact, handling telephone enquiries with professionalism, empathy, accuracy and within a timely manner
  • Support patient journey, including processing discharges in line with local policies
  • Ensuring your own and shared mailboxes are regularly monitored and responded to promptly, escalating any potential problems
  • Provide a wide range of administrative support, including producing and printing letters, managing documents, scanning, minute taking, and handling post and sensitive information
  • Deliver excellent customer service, responding to patient enquiries with understanding and care in line with Sirona values
  • Supporting colleagues, contributing to the wider effectiveness of the team
  • Manage priorities and deadlines in a changing environment
  • Inputting data information  from local improvement audits
  • Taking part in regular team meetings, supervision and performance reviews
